The college mascot is the Comet, and the team colors are silver and scarlet. The college has men’s and women’s cross country, water polo, swimming, soccer, tennis, volleyball and basketball teams.
Palomar College is in a small city, in San Marcos, CA. The school is classified as a public college. Students at Palomar College earn degrees up to the Associate's degree.
The most common major fields study at the school include media and liberal arts.
All qualified applicants are admitted as Palomar College offers open admission.
Some professors at the school are awarded tenure, allowing the school to retain good faculty members. Faculty salaries at Palomar College are higher than most.
The school, in 2007, had 27,222 students (14,861 full-time equivalent).
Degree seekers find Palomar College to be more affordable than many of its peers.

The school does not offer campus housing.
(Please refer to our profile of San Marcos, California for details about the area surrounding the campus. Also see our list of other California Colleges).
The school does not offer students a meal plan.
Expenses and Financial Aid:
| Expense | Amount |
|---|---|
| In-state tuition and fees | $ 600 |
| Out-of-state tuition and fees | $ 5,164 |
| Books and supplies | $ 1,386 |
Financial Aid:
Palomar College participates in Federal Title IV financial aid programs. (The school's OPE ID is 126000)
